Phase 1 registration for the TSICET Counselling for 2023 is scheduled to start on September 6. To be considered, prospective applicants must submit their online applications by September 11th. The TSICET Phase 1 Seat Allotment Results will thereafter be made public on September 17th. The JET exam for B.Tech is of 150 marks having 5 subjects- Physics (30), Chemistry (30), Mathematics (30), LR (30), English (30). Time is 3 hours in online mode.The cut off for JET  B.Tech is released rank wise and the result can be accessed by the official sites. The cut off varies from course to course because of the seats available and the applicants for the course received.

The placement at faculty of engineering in Jain deemed to be University is really worthy and good. The statistics shows the following data of 2023 B-Tec and M.Tech placements1.B-Tech ,407/750students got placed and its placement rate is 54%. The highest package of INR 30 LPA and average package of INR 6.92 LPA. 2. M-Tech, 5/47 students were placed that is 10% placement rate. The highest placement was INR 9 LPA and average placement of INR 5.85 LPA.
